Scotland’s First Minister John Swinney on Tuesday criticized the actions of the US and Israel in Iran, saying they “have no basis under international law,” Anadolu reports. “So let me be clear, the unjustifiable actions of the US and Israel have no basis under international law. They must stop for the sake of innocent children in Iran, for the sake of peace,” he said in a post on the US social media company X. “Right now, once again, the world is watching as war rages in the Middle East. We all know the Iranian regime is brutal and illegitimate. It has brought untold suffering on its own citizens and on people across the region,” he added. READ: UK ‘will not be drawn […]
